Buffy stared at the book that lay in front of her. She was at the Bronze and Willow was tutoring her, since she had recently failed a history test. She was hoping to get her grades up since she promised to her mom she'd do better. It was going to be a hard promise to keep.
"When did the Hundred Years War began?" Willow quizzed, closing Buffy's book.
"Uh, a hundred years ago," Buffy answered.
"No, it started in 1336. You almost got it though, you were just a couple of six hundred years or so off," Willow told her best friend.
"Who needs this stuff anyway," Buffy muttered.
"Hey Will, how about we take a break. It's been what ten minutes of studying. That's gotta be a record, please?" she asked.
Willow stared at her friend, and answered, "Okay, Buffy but we have to study some more later."
Buffy nodded in agreement. They both stared at the band that was getting ready to perform. They were setting up their equipment on stage. Buffy noticed that one of the members of the band looked familiar.
"Hey, isn't that Oz?" she asked Willow.
Willow looked at each of the band members and finally spotted who Buffy was talking about.
"Yeah," Willow confirmed.
"I didn't know he was in a band," Buffy said.
" I did, I've seen them practice around school," Willow said shyly.
"I think you should talk to Oz."
"Me talk to him. No, I couldn't," Willow began.
Buffy cut her off, "Can't or won't? Come on Willow please talk to him. Its obvious you like him."
Buffy stood up and pulled Willow alongside her as they approached the stage. Oz was busy fixing some equipment that he didn't notice the two girls in front of him.
"Plug," he said.
"What?" Buffy asked confused.
"Watch out for the plug," he explained, pointing to the plug on the floor. Buffy and Willow avoided it.
Buffy poked Willow, to get her to start talking. Willow gave Buffy a look, but decided to speak, "Hi, I'm uh, Willow, I showed you to class the other day."
"Oh, yeah that's why you looked familiar," he said.
"Yeah, that's me girl that showed you to class. Oh and this is Buffy, a friend of mine," Willow pointed to Buffy.
He greeted her with a nod of his head. " I'm going to get a drink now, so I'll leave you guys to talk," Buffy said as she backed away from them.
Willow shot her a look, clearly saying that she didn't want to be left alone. As, Buffy backed away she bumped into someone. She turned to face the person she bumped into.
"You really should watch where you're going, luv," Spike said.
"Well, I'm sorry, next time I'll be careful and don't call me luv," Buffy said as she crossed her arms.
"You got a date tonight luv, or why the rush to back away from those lovebirds unless you're just here to sulk 'cause you're lonely," he said indicating Willow and Oz who seemed to be talking.
"I, uh,. have a date as a matter of fact and I'm going to see him now," she said as she pushed past Spike. She had just seen Angel enter the building. She really didn't have a date, but she hadn't been willing to admit that she didn't.
"Hey Angel," she greeted the dark haired vampire.
"Hi, Buffy," he replied.
"What brings you here among the living," she whispered so that only he would hear. "I just thought I'd go out tonight," he explained.
"Hmm, kinda hard to believe, but it must be true unless you got some bad news," she said.
The band was on stage now performing a song. For a moment Buffy and Angel just stared at the people dancing. " Wanna dance?" she asked Angel. He replied with a yes, they joined the other people. As, they danced she spotted Spike dancing with some girl she didn't know.
Xander was at the bar trying to flirt with a girl. "I'm a dangerous guy," he told the girl, who held a doubtful look on her face.
"I'm very dangerous. I'm dangerously.."
"Dangerously cheesy," a voice quipped behind him. He turned to see Cordelia and her followers. "Oh, its you," he muttered.
The girl who he had been trying to flirt with left with a drink in hand. "Looks like you can't get a date. I wonder why, with those lame pick up lines and that shirt from like a century ago I can't blame girls," Cordelia said.
Xander grabbed his drink and said lamely, "At least I uh don't worship some fashion god."
After a couple of songs, Buffy and Angel headed for the table she and Willow had previously occupied. They sat in silence. Buffy noticed what time it was and she said, " I have to go now, tomorrow I have to wake up early to help my mom with some stuff. Tell Willow that I had to go please?" Angel nodded. She picked up her book and left the Bronze.
